Full Description
The author of many monographs, edited collections, and essays, Seyed Javad Miri has been a major influence in social sciences and humanities. His significant contributions disrupted prevailing narratives surrounding critical issues, including nationality, identity, secularism, religion, and modernity. In Beyond Eurocentric Social Theory: The Nomadic Intellectual on Religion, Culture and the State, the contributors illustrate different dimensions of Seyed Javad Miri's oeuvre and demonstrate how his scholarship bridge the Eastern and Western intellectual traditions and foster a dialogue at the global level between Iranian intellectual history, Islamic philosophy and Western social theory.
Contributors are: Joseph Alagha, Syed Farid Alatas, Ali Almasizand, Krikor Ankeshian, Dustin J. Byrd, Ramze Endut, Meisam Ghavehchian, Carimo Mohomed, Michael Naughton, Aditya Nigam, Hossein Roohani, Mehdi Shariati, and Esmaeil Zeiny.
